Unlike traditional filters, the 3M Aqua-Pure AP430SS doesn’t just filter water but actively inhibits scale formation through polyphosphates, making it a valuable addition for anyone concerned with durability and maintenance of their appliances. The system maintains high flow rates of up to 10 gallons per minute, ensuring that my household’s water needs are met without any noticeable drop in pressure.

2:Why do I need a water filter for my tankless water heater?

A water filter helps protect your tankless water heater from mineral buildup and sediment, which can reduce efficiency and lifespan.
